First Consultation
The first consultation for dental implants is a vital step in your journey towards a brought back smile. During this consultation, you'll consult with your dental practitioner to review your oral health and certain needs.
They'll review your mouth, take X-rays, and may also make use of 3D imaging to examine the bone framework where the dental implant will certainly go. This thorough evaluation helps them determine if you're a good candidate for the procedure.
veneers 'll likewise review your medical history, consisting of any medications you're taking, to ensure there are no problems. Your dental expert will describe the advantages of oral implants and just how they vary from various other tooth replacement options, such as dentures or bridges.
They'll resolve any kind of worries you have and respond to all your concerns, seeing to it you really feel comfy moving on.
This examination is additionally the time to discuss the timeline for the whole process, along with the expenses entailed. Comprehending what to anticipate can help ease any anxiousness you might have.
Procedure
Undertaking the surgery for dental implants marks an important action in attaining a long-term smile. On the day of your surgical procedure, you'll get to the dental office or medical center, where the team will certainly lead you via the process.
You'll get anesthetic to ensure your comfort throughout the treatment, which might entail neighborhood anesthesia, sedation, or general anesthetic, relying on your needs.
Once you're comfortable, your dentist will certainly make a small incision in your periodontal to reveal the underlying bone. https://louisokezu.blog2freedom.com/32687690/take-the-primary-step-towards-your-perfect-smile-with-invisalign-uncover-what-takes-place-throughout-your-preliminary-see-and-the-exciting-trip-in-advance 'll then pierce a tiny opening into the bone to produce an area for the titanium dental implant post. This post will work as the root for your brand-new tooth.
After putting the dental implant, the dental practitioner will certainly protect the periodontal cells over it, enabling the implant to integrate with the bone over the coming months.
This treatment normally takes one to 2 hours, depending on the variety of implants being positioned. You could really feel some stress, however pain must be marginal because of the anesthetic.

Healing and Aftercare
After the operation, your focus shifts to healing and aftercare to make certain the best outcomes for your oral implants.
In the very first couple of days, you might experience swelling and discomfort. It's essential to follow your dental expert's post-operative instructions, which might include taking prescribed discomfort drugs and applying ice packs to reduce swelling.
https://noosatoday.com.au/in-business/04-08-2023/locally-owned-dental-clinic/ need to stick to soft foods and prevent eating on the dental implant website for a minimum of a week. This aids stop any type of anxiety on the location as it recovers.
Keep your mouth clean by delicately washing with salt water, however stay clear of vigorous swishing that might disturb the surgical site.
Bear in mind any indications of infection, such as increased pain, swelling, or fever. If you see anything unusual, contact your dental practitioner quickly.
It's likewise crucial to attend your follow-up consultations, as your dentist will monitor your recovery procedure and see to it everything gets on track.
As you recoup, be patient. Complete recovery can take numerous months, but with correct care, your oral implants will certainly integrate with your jawbone, giving a steady structure for your new teeth.
